OpenSSH VPN是一款安全高效的远程访问解决方案,采用SSH协议,保障数据传输安全,支持多种加密算法,适用于企业级远程办公需求。简单易用,部署快速,提升工作效率。
在互联网技术迅猛发展的今天,远程接入已成为现代企业运营的关键组成部分,为了确保远程接入的安全性及效率,OpenSSH VPN作为一种开放源代码、高度安全的远程接入方案,受到了企业和用户的广泛推崇,本文将深入探讨OpenSSH VPN的特点、配置步骤以及其在实际应用中的显著优势。
OpenSSH VPN简介
OpenSSH(Secure Shell)是一种网络协议,旨在实现计算机之间的安全通信,OpenSSH VPN基于此协议,通过加密隧道提供远程接入服务,具备以下显著特性:
- 安全性:采用SSL/TLS加密算法,确保数据在传输过程中的安全,有效预防数据泄露和未授权访问。
- 高效性:提供快速的连接速度,满足大多数远程接入需求。
- 开源性:作为开源软件,用户可根据实际需求进行定制和优化。
- 易用性:配置过程相对简便,适合不同水平的用户。
- 兼容性:支持多种操作系统,包括Windows、Linux、macOS等。
OpenSSH VPN配置方法
以下以Linux系统为例,介绍OpenSSH VPN的配置步骤:
- 安装OpenSSH服务器
- 生成密钥
- 将公钥复制到客户端
- 配置客户端
- 连接VPN
在服务器端,需安装OpenSSH服务器,以CentOS系统为例,使用以下命令进行安装:
yum install openssh-server
在服务器端生成一对密钥(私钥和公钥),私钥用于客户端连接,公钥用于服务器端认证,使用以下命令生成密钥:
ssh-keygen -t rsa -b 2048
将生成的公钥复制到客户端,可以使用以下命令实现:
ssh-copy-id 用户名@服务器IP
在客户端,配置SSH客户端以便通过VPN连接到服务器,以Linux系统为例,编辑SSH客户端配置文件:
vi ~/.ssh/config
添加以下内容:
Host 服务器别名
HostName 服务器IP
User 用户名
IdentityFile 客户端私钥路径
在客户端,使用以下命令连接VPN:
ssh 服务器别名
OpenSSH VPN在实际应用中的优势
- 降低成本:作为开源软件,OpenSSH VPN避免了昂贵的VPN设备或服务费用。
- 增强安全性:SSL/TLS加密算法有效防止数据泄露和非法访问。
- 多场景适用:适用于企业内部网络、远程办公、移动办公等多种场景。
- 兼容性强:支持多种操作系统,便于用户在多个平台上使用。
- 易于扩展:可与其他安全协议(如IPSec)结合,进一步提升安全性。
OpenSSH VPN作为一种安全、高效的远程接入解决方案,不仅保障了数据安全,还提供了便捷的远程接入体验,随着我国互联网事业的持续发展,OpenSSH VPN将在更多领域发挥其重要作用。
相关阅读: